Thomas Stolze is a scholar working on Urology, Rheumatology and Surgery. According to data from OpenAlex, Thomas Stolze has authored 9 papers receiving a total of 438 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 8 papers in Urology, 7 papers in Rheumatology and 1 paper in Surgery. Recurrent topics in Thomas Stolze’s work include Urinary Bladder and Prostate Research (7 papers), Pelvic Floor Disorders (6 papers) and Urological Disorders and Treatments (5 papers). Thomas Stolze is often cited by papers focused on Urinary Bladder and Prostate Research (7 papers), Pelvic Floor Disorders (6 papers) and Urological Disorders and Treatments (5 papers). Thomas Stolze collaborates with scholars based in Germany. Thomas Stolze's co-authors include Heinrich Schulte‐Baukloh, Helmut H. Knispel, Catarina Weiß, B. Stürzebecher, Kurt Miller, Berthold Hocher, H Halle, Torsten Slowinski, Hans‐H. Neumayer and Gerd Mürtz and has published in prestigious journals such as European Urology, Urology and Clinical Science.
